interface Tap { (data: T): T; fmt: (fmt: string) => (data: T) => T; } /** ## `tap` : 用于控制台输出的MiddleWare @example Usage - tap for console log ```ts const res = pipe(1,(v)=>v+2,tap,(v)=>v*2 ) assert(res === 6) //控制台输出: 3 ``` @example Uasge - tap for implements Debug ````ts // 对于实现Debug的数据结构直接调用log()方法 pipe( AnyErr(),tap) //控制台输出: AnyErr 的log()方法 ``` @category MiddleWare */ export declare const tap: Tap; export {}; //# sourceMappingURL=tap.d.ts.map